Problems solved by technology

The following difficulty arises when pre-treating urea solutions in exhaust gases: in addition to the desired thermal decomposition chemical reaction releasing ammonia, crystalline by-products may also be produced

Embodiment Construction

[0029] figure 1An exhaust gas aftertreatment system 1 for an internal combustion engine of a motor vehicle is shown in a simplified sectional illustration. The exhaust gas aftertreatment system 1 has an exhaust gas line 2 and an exhaust gas inlet 3 , which is connected to an internal combustion engine. Arranged in the exhaust gas line 2 is, for example, a first catalytic converter 4 and a particle filter 5 downstream of the catalytic converter 4 , which treat the exhaust gas flowing into the exhaust gas line 2 in a known manner. The exhaust gas line 2 merges into an exhaust gas supply channel 6 for an exhaust gas aftertreatment device 7 , which will be described in more detail below.

Abstract

The invention relates to an exhaust aftertreatment device (7) for metering a liquid aftertreatment agent into an exhaust stream of an internal combustion engine, comprising a mixing chamber (22), in which the exhaust aftertreatment agent is mixed with the exhaust stream, a mixing chamber (22) having a circularly cylindrical mixing pipe (8), which has a funnel-shaped end section (9) widening the periphery toward a free end, having a funnel element (17) opening at least partly conically in the direction of the mixing pipe (8), which has a plurality of passage openings (18) in the lateral wall (19) of the funnel element, and wherein an injection valve (21) for the exhaust aftertreatment agent is arranged at the end of the funnel element (17) that faces away from the mixing tube (8), in orderto inject the exhaust aftertreatment agent into the funnel element (17). According to the invention, the funnel element (17) is located at least substantially within the end section (9), coaxially with respect to the end section, and at least some of the passage openings (18) are each assigned a flow element (20) rising up from the lateral wall (19) to produce a swirling flow in the mixing pipe (8).
